The brief

Reed in Partnership plans to bid as a prime for the Refugee Employment Programme (REP), commissioned by the Home Office.

Delivery is expected to commence in Spring 2023 and run until 2025.

The REP aims to enhance support already provided to refugees to help them integrate and become self-sufficient quickly.

The REP objectives include: • Supporting refugees into sustainable employment, tailored to the individual refugee's needs & skills • Supporting a holistic approach through partnership working • Alignment with existing local services to ensure a joined-up package of support • Supporting those assessed as needing additional support in addition to mainstream services e.g.

DWP Job Centre Plus Network and Adult Education Budget (i.e., they would not be able to progress to self-sufficiency with mainstream support alone).

We are seeking expressions of interest (EOI) from: ESOL (English for Speakers of Other Languages) Providers that can deliver: English language training.

The REP applies to England only.

Please note: Requirements of this contract (including geographical lot configurations, contract duration, ESOL training deliverables and volumes) may change once the final bidding documents are released by the Home Office.
